Property Details for 25 Atkell Ave, Campbelltown

25 Atkell Ave, Campbelltown is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2013. The property has a land size of 348m2 and floor size of 190m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2022.

About Campbelltown 5074

The size of Campbelltown is approximately 3.5 square kilometres. It has 19 parks covering nearly 14.5% of total area. The population of Campbelltown in 2016 was 8156 people. By 2021 the population was 9263 showing a population growth of 13.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Campbelltown is 30-39 years. Households in Campbelltown are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Campbelltown work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.50% of the homes in Campbelltown were owner-occupied compared with 58.10% in 2016.

Campbelltown has 4,801 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Campbelltown have seen a 100.33%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 97.60% increase. As at 30 April 2026:
